SPOILER ALERT: You need to temporarily install ME1 in Origin(And we wonder how they won two years in a row). Steams version of ME1 doesn’t have any of the DLC, which is why we need to borrow EA’s Origin.

Now that you have EA installed and you’re signed in. We need to tell EA that you own a copy on steam.


As the image above shows, get your CD key and bring it over to the origin client.

Now you know where to redeem that key.

Now install and go play some games on steam while you wait.

Transplant the DLC

Finished that install? Awesome. Now we’re going to liberate the DLC from the Heresy EA’s Origin.

The Origin client will tell you where it installed ME1, you’re going to that location and find a folder named “DLC”. Slow down, you’re going to take the folder “DLC_Vegas” and bring it to the DLC folder of your steam copy of ME1. DLC_UNC is the Bringing Down the Sky DLC, which has an actual legit installer and a guide for where to get that. [link]

Now that you’ve copied the DLC you going uninstall the Origin copy and then revisit the location of your steam copy of ME1. There’s a folder called binaries and in it a program called “MassEffectConfig.exe” run it and then click the word repair. Now you’re going to click the button that reads “Delete Local Shader Cache Files”. But we’re not done yet.

Go back to where your steam copy of ME1 and go into “DLCDLC_Vegas” and create an .ini file named “autoload.ini“(see disclaimer). You’re going to paste the following into the file.

[Packages] 2DA1=BIOG_2DA_Vegas_GalaxyMap_X 2DA2=BIOG_2DA_Vegas_Merge_X 2DA3=BIOG_2DA_Vegas_AreaMap_X 2DA4=BIOG_2DA_Vegas_UI_X 2DA5=BIOG_2DA_Vegas_TreasureTables_X DotU1=PlotManagerDLC_Vegas PlotManagerConditionals1=PlotManagerDLC_Vegas.BioAutoConditionals PlotManagerStateTransitionMap1=PlotManagerAutoDLC_Vegas.StateTransitionMap PlotManagerConsequenceMap1=PlotManagerAutoDLC_Vegas.ConsequenceMap PlotManagerOutcomeMap1=PlotManagerAutoDLC_Vegas.OutcomeMap PlotManagerQuestMap1=PlotManagerAutoDLC_Vegas.QuestMap PlotManagerCodexMap1=PlotManagerAutoDLC_Vegas.DataCodexMap GlobalTalkTable1=DLC_Vegas_GlobalTlk.GlobalTlk_tlk GlobalTalkTable1_ES=DLC_Vegas_GlobalTlk_ES.GlobalTlk_tlk GlobalTalkTable1_PL=DLC_Vegas_GlobalTlk_PL.GlobalTlk_tlk GlobalTalkTable1_DE=DLC_Vegas_GlobalTlk_DE.GlobalTlk_tlk GlobalTalkTable1_IT=DLC_Vegas_GlobalTlk_IT.GlobalTlk_tlk GlobalTalkTable1_FR=DLC_Vegas_GlobalTlk_FR.GlobalTlk_tlk GlobalTalkTable1_CS=DLC_Vegas_GlobalTlk_CS.GlobalTlk_tlk GlobalTalkTable1_HU=DLC_Vegas_GlobalTlk_HU.GlobalTlk_tlk GlobalTalkTable1_PLPC=DLC_Vegas_GlobalTlk_PLPC.GlobalTlk_tlk GlobalTalkTable1_RU=DLC_Vegas_GlobalTlk_RU.GlobalTlk_tlk GlobalTalkTable1_RA=DLC_Vegas_GlobalTlk_RA.GlobalTlk_tlk [GUI] NameStrRef=182170 DescriptionStrRef=182209 ImagePackage=”GUI_SF_PRC2_SaveLoad.Images_PRC2″ ImageFrame=”shotOne” CreditsFile=”BIOCredits_DLC_Vegas.ini”

Now you can launch Mass Effect and enjoy your DLC.

This is what you’ll see in the steam version if you followed the guide.

With all this done you can now uninstall the Origin version as well as the Origin client.

Bad keys? Blame EA(politely)

Some users on steam have stated they have an issue redeeming keys through origin and from what I’ve found, EA is giving out bad keys to Valve which hands those keys off to users automatically. I haven’t found a perfect fix for this yet as there isn’t a way to buy pinnacle station through EA anymore. And EA’s support is giving users mixed results for keys.

TL;DR If you cannot redeem it in Origin contact EA’s support and be very polite. They may have a portion of your game hostage, but that doesn’t mean they won’t pull the trigger so to speak. Results may vary so don’t worsen your odds.
